Classic Grilled Cheese With a Twist

There’s something timeless about a classic grilled cheese sandwich, but adding a modern twist can elevate it to a whole new level. This specialty grilled cheese combines the traditional elements of ooey-gooey cheese and crispy bread with the added flair of gourmet ingredients. By incorporating a mix of cheeses, crispy bacon, and fresh basil, this recipe is sure to become a favorite for both kids and adults alike.
Perfect for a cozy family gathering or a casual dinner, this recipe serves 4-6 people. The combination of sharp cheddar, creamy brie, and tangy goat cheese creates a delightful medley of flavors, while the bacon and basil add a surprising yet harmonious touch. Whether you’re a grilled cheese aficionado or trying this dish for the first time, this recipe is easy to follow and sure to impress.
Ingredients for 4-6 Servings:
- 12 slices of sourdough bread
- 1 cup shredded sharp cheddar cheese
- 1 cup sliced brie cheese
- 1 cup crumbled goat cheese
- 12 slices of cooked crispy bacon
- 1 bunch of fresh basil leaves
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
- Salt and pepper to taste
Cooking Instructions:
- Prepare the Ingredients: Start by cooking the bacon until crispy. Set aside on a paper towel-lined plate to drain excess grease. Wash the basil leaves thoroughly and pat them dry with a paper towel.
- Assemble the Sandwiches: Lay out the slices of sourdough bread on a clean surface. Spread a thin layer of softened butter on one side of each slice. Flip the slices over and layer each with the three types of cheese: sharp cheddar, brie, and goat cheese.
- Add Bacon and Basil: Place two slices of crispy bacon and a few basil leaves on top of the cheese for half of the bread slices. Cover with the other slices of bread, buttered side up, to form a complete sandwich.
- Preheat the Pan: Heat a large non-stick skillet or griddle over medium heat. Allow it to warm up for about 2 minutes before adding any sandwiches.
- Cook the Sandwiches: Place the sandwiches onto the skillet, pressing down lightly with a spatula. Cook for 3-4 minutes on each side, or until the bread is golden brown and the cheese is fully melted. Adjust the heat as necessary to avoid burning.
- Serve Immediately: Once cooked, remove the sandwiches from the skillet and let them rest for a minute. Cut each sandwich diagonally and serve warm.
Extra Tips:
For ideal results, verify that the cheeses are at room temperature before assembling the sandwiches. This helps them melt evenly and smoothly. If you prefer a gooier filling, consider adding a bit more cheese or a splash of cream to the goat cheese before assembling.
Don’t rush the cooking process; medium heat allows the bread to crisp up perfectly without burning while the cheese melts to perfection. Finally, experiment with additional ingredients like sliced tomatoes or caramelized onions for added flavor and texture. Enjoy your twist on a classic favorite!
Savory Apple and Cheddar Melt

The Savory Apple and Cheddar Melt is a delightful take on the classic grilled cheese sandwich, perfect for those who enjoy a mix of sweet and savory flavors. This gourmet sandwich combines the sharpness of aged cheddar cheese with the sweetness of crisp apple slices, all nestled between slices of artisan bread. The combination of flavors and textures makes it an ideal choice for a comforting lunch or a light dinner.
This recipe is designed to serve 4-6 people, making it perfect for a family meal or a small gathering. The addition of caramelized onions and a touch of Dijon mustard elevates the sandwich to a sophisticated level, while still being simple enough to prepare on a busy weeknight. The Savory Apple and Cheddar Melt is best served warm, straight from the pan, guaranteeing the cheese is perfectly melted and gooey.
Ingredients for 4-6 servings:
- 8-12 slices of artisan bread (such as sourdough or multigrain)
- 2-3 medium apples (such as Granny Smith or Honeycrisp), thinly sliced
- 2 cups aged cheddar cheese, shredded
- 1 large onion, thinly sliced
- 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 tablespoons Dijon mustard
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Optional: fresh thyme leaves for garnish
Cooking Instructions:
- Prepare the Ingredients: Begin by washing the apples thoroughly and slicing them thinly. Keep the skins on for added texture. Shred the aged cheddar cheese and set aside.
- Caramelize the Onions: In a skillet, he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il over medium heat. Add the sliced onions and a pinch of salt. Cook, stirring occasionally, for about 15-20 minutes or until the onions are golden brown and caramelized. Remove from heat and set aside.
- Assemble the Sandwiches: Lay out the slices of bread on a clean surface. Spread a thin layer of Dijon mustard on one side of each slice of bread. On half of the slices, layer the shredded cheddar cheese, caramelized onions, and apple slices. Season with a little salt and pepper. Top with the remaining bread slices, mustard side down, to form sandwiches.
- Grill the Sandwiches: In a large skillet or griddle, melt 2 tablespoons of unsalted butter over medium heat. Place the sandwiches in the skillet and cook for about 3-4 minutes on each side, or until the bread is golden brown and the cheese is melted. You may need to cook in batches depending on the size of your skillet.
- Serve: Once cooked, remove the sandwiches from the skillet and let them sit for a minute or two before slicing. Garnish with fresh thyme leaves if desired. Serve warm.
Extra Tips:
For the best results, choose apples that are firm and slightly tart, as they complement the richness of the cheddar cheese beautifully. If you prefer a milder flavor, you can substitute the aged cheddar with a milder variety such as Monterey Jack or Gruyere.
To make the sandwiches even more indulgent, consider adding a slice of prosciutto or bacon. When grilling, press down lightly with a spatula to guarantee even cooking and maximum crispiness. Enjoy your Savory Apple and Cheddar Melt with a side of tomato soup for a classic pairing.
Spicy Jalapeño Popper Toastie

The Spicy Jalapeño Popper Toastie is a delightful twist on the classic grilled cheese sandwich, designed to tantalize your taste buds with its bold flavors and creamy texture. This toastie combines the heat of fresh jalapeños with the rich, creamy texture of cream cheese, all sandwiched between two slices of perfectly toasted bread. It’s an ideal option for those who enjoy a bit of spice in their meals and are looking to elevate their grilled cheese experience. Perfect for a weekend lunch or a fun dinner, this dish promises to be a hit with spicy food lovers.
The beauty of this toastie lies in its simple yet flavorful ingredients that come together to create a deliciously satisfying meal. The cream cheese provides a smooth base that perfectly balances the heat from the jalapeños, while a mix of cheeses adds depth and richness. The bread is toasted to golden perfection, providing the perfect crunchy contrast to the creamy and spicy filling.
Whether served with a side of soup or on its own, the Spicy Jalapeño Popper Toastie is sure to impress and satisfy.
Ingredients (Serves 4-6):
- 12 slices of sourdough bread
- 8 oz (225 g) cream cheese, softened
- 8 oz (225 g) shredded cheddar cheese
- 8 oz (225 g) shredded mozzarella cheese
- 4 fresh jalapeños, seeded and diced
- 1/2 cup (120 ml) mayonnaise
- 1/4 cup (60 ml) butter, softened
- Salt and pepper to taste
Cooking Instructions:
- Prepare the Jalapeño Mixture: In a medium-sized bowl, combine the softened cream cheese, shredded cheddar, shredded mozzarella, and diced jalapeños. Mix well until all ingredients are evenly incorporated. Season the mixture with salt and pepper to taste.
- Assemble the Sandwiches: Lay out the slices of sourdough bread. Spread a thin layer of mayonnaise on one side of each slice. On the opposite side of half of the bread slices, spread a generous amount of the jalapeño cheese mixture. Top each with another slice of bread, mayonnaise side out, to form a sandwich.
- Preheat the Pan: Heat a large skillet or griddle over medium heat. Add a small amount of butter to the pan and let it melt, making sure it coats the surface evenly.
- Grill the Sandwiches: Place the assembled sandwiches in the skillet, cooking in batches if necessary. Grill each sandwich for 3-4 minutes on each side, or until the bread is golden brown and the cheese mixture is melted and bubbly.
- Serve Hot: Once all sandwiches are cooked, remove them from the skillet. Allow them to rest for a minute or two before slicing and serving. Enjoy your Spicy Jalapeño Popper Toastie while it’s hot and the cheese is still gooey.
Extra Tips:
For an added touch of flavor, consider adding a sprinkle of crumbled bacon to the jalapeño cheese mixture for a smoky kick. If you prefer a milder heat, you can reduce the number of jalapeños or substitute with a milder pepper.
To guarantee even melting, make sure the cream cheese is fully softened before mixing, as this will help it blend more easily with the other cheeses. Finally, keep a close eye on your sandwiches while grilling to avoid burning the bread – a medium heat is key to achieving the perfect golden crust.
Brie and Fig Gourmet Sandwich

Indulge in the creamy, sweet, and savory flavors of a Brie and Fig Gourmet Sandwich, a delightful twist on the classic grilled cheese. This specialty sandwich combines the rich creaminess of Brie cheese with the sweet and slightly tart flavor of fig jam, all encased within a perfectly toasted crust. The combination of textures and flavors makes this sandwich an extraordinary treat that can be enjoyed as a luxurious lunch or a sophisticated snack.
Whether you’re hosting a gathering or treating yourself to an elevated meal, this sandwich is bound to impress. The Brie and Fig Gourmet Sandwich isn’t only a feast for the taste buds but also a visual delight. The gooey melted Brie contrasts beautifully with the deep, jeweled tones of the fig jam, while the crispy, golden-brown bread adds an inviting crunch.
This recipe is simple enough to prepare in under 30 minutes, yet elegant enough to make any occasion feel special. Perfect for serving 4-6 people, this dish is an excellent choice for a small get-together or a family meal.
Ingredients for 4-6 servings:
- 12 slices of rustic sourdough or French bread
- 1 pound (about 16 ounces) of Brie cheese, sliced
- 1 cup of fig jam
- 1/2 cup of unsalted butter, softened
- 1/2 cup of arugula or baby spinach (optional)
- Salt and pepper to taste
Cooking Instructions:
- Prepare the Bread: Begin by spreading a thin layer of softened butter on one side of each slice of bread. This will help achieve a crispy, golden exterior.
- Assemble the Sandwiches: Lay out 6 slices of bread, butter side down. On each slice, spread a generous tablespoon of fig jam, ensuring even coverage. Next, layer slices of Brie cheese over the jam. If desired, add a few leaves of arugula or baby spinach for a fresh, peppery contrast.
- Complete the Sandwiches: Top each assembled slice with another slice of bread, butter side up, to form a sandwich.
- Preheat the Pan: Heat a large non-stick skillet or griddle over medium heat. You want the pan hot enough to toast the bread without burning it, so adjust as necessary.
- Grill the Sandwiches: Place the sandwiches in the preheated skillet. Cook for about 3-5 minutes on each side, or until the bread is golden brown and the Brie is melted. Press down gently with a spatula to verify even cooking.
- Serve Immediately: Once done, remove the sandwiches from the skillet and let them cool for a minute before slicing. Season with a pinch of salt and pepper, if desired, before serving.
Extra Tips:
To elevate your Brie and Fig Gourmet Sandwich further, consider adding a handful of toasted walnuts for an added crunch. If you prefer a more savory note, a thin layer of prosciutto or crispy bacon can provide a delicious balance to the sweetness of the fig jam.
For best results, confirm the Brie is at room temperature before slicing to make it easier to handle. Finally, monitor the heat closely while grilling to prevent the bread from burning before the cheese has time to melt. Enjoy your culinary creation with a side salad or a glass of wine for the perfect gourmet experience.
Pesto and Mozzarella Grilled Delight

Indulge in a culinary experience that elevates the classic grilled cheese sandwich into a gourmet delight with our Pesto and Mozzarella Grilled Delight. This recipe combines the creamy richness of fresh mozzarella with the aromatic freshness of pesto, all encased in perfectly toasted, golden-brown bread. The moment you bite into this sandwich, you’ll be greeted with the melted goodness of cheese mingling with the nutty, herbal notes of basil pesto, creating a symphony of flavors that’s both simple and sophisticated.
This dish is perfect for a cozy lunch or a satisfying dinner and is sure to impress your family or guests. The Pesto and Mozzarella Grilled Delight isn’t only delicious but also quick and easy to prepare, making it an ideal choice for both novice and experienced home cooks. In just a few steps, you can transform simple ingredients into a gourmet masterpiece that serves 4-6 people, perfect for family gatherings or a friendly get-together.
Ingredients (Serves 4-6):
- 8-12 slices of sourdough bread
- 2 cups of fresh mozzarella cheese, sliced
- 1 cup of basil pesto
- 1/2 cup of sun-dried tomatoes, chopped
- Butter for spreading
- Olive oil for grilling
Cooking Instructions:
- Prepare the Bread: Spread butter evenly on one side of each slice of sourdough bread. This will help achieve a crispy exterior when grilled.
- Assemble the Sandwich: On the unbuttered side of half the slices, spread a generous layer of basil pesto. Follow this by layering slices of fresh mozzarella and a sprinkle of chopped sun-dried tomatoes.
- Close the Sandwich: Top each assembled slice with another slice of bread, buttered side facing out.
- Preheat the Pan: Heat a large skillet or griddle over medium heat. Drizzle a little olive oil in the pan to enhance the toasting process.
- Grill the Sandwiches: Place the sandwiches onto the preheated skillet, ensuring they aren’t overcrowded. Grill each side for about 3-4 minutes, or until the bread is golden brown and the cheese has melted thoroughly.
- Serve Warm: Once grilled to perfection, remove the sandwiches from the skillet. Let them cool for a minute before cutting them in half, then serve immediately for best results.
Extra Tips:
To make your Pesto and Mozzarella Grilled Delight even more delightful, consider using homemade pesto for an extra burst of freshness. If you prefer a little more texture, try adding a handful of arugula or spinach before closing the sandwich.
Also, to guarantee the cheese melts evenly, allow it to come to room temperature before assembling the sandwiches. If you find the bread browning too quickly, lower the heat slightly to give the cheese enough time to melt without burning the bread.
Enjoy your culinary creation with a side of tomato soup or a fresh green salad for a complete meal.
Feta and Tomato Grilled Cheese

Feta and Tomato Grilled Cheese sandwiches are a delightful twist on the classic comfort food, bringing together the tangy, creamy flavor of feta cheese with the bright, fresh taste of tomatoes. This Mediterranean-inspired version of the traditional grilled cheese is perfect for a quick lunch or a light dinner, and it brings a touch of sophistication to a beloved favorite.
Using high-quality ingredients will elevate this sandwich into a gourmet experience that’s sure to satisfy both kids and adults alike. The combination of feta cheese, juicy tomatoes, and crispy, buttery bread creates a perfect balance of flavors and textures. The salty, crumbly feta melts beautifully, mingling with the slightly sweet and acidic tomatoes, while the bread provides a satisfying crunch with each bite.
This recipe makes enough for 4-6 people, making it ideal for family meals or casual gatherings with friends. Serve with a fresh green salad or a bowl of soup for a complete and satisfying meal.
Ingredients (serving size: 4-6 people):
- 12 slices of sturdy bread (such as sourdough or ciabatta)
- 1 cup crumbled feta cheese
- 2 large tomatoes, sliced
- 1/2 cup fresh basil leaves
- 1/4 cup olive oil
- 1/2 cup butter, softened
- Salt and pepper to taste
Cooking Instructions:
- Prepare the Ingredients: Begin by gathering all your ingredients. Slice the tomatoes into thin rounds and crumble the feta cheese if it isn’t already crumbled. Wash and dry the basil leaves.
- Preheat the Pan: Heat a large skillet or griddle over medium heat. You want it hot enough to toast the bread but not so hot that it burns before the cheese melts.
- Assemble the Sandwiches: Lay out the slices of bread on a clean surface. Brush the outside of each slice with olive oil. On the inside of half of the bread slices, spread a generous layer of softened butter. Then, sprinkle crumbled feta cheese over the buttered side, add a few tomato slices, and top with fresh basil leaves. Season lightly with salt and pepper.
- Close the Sandwiches: Top each sandwich with another slice of bread, olive oil side up. Press down gently to make sure everything holds together.
- Grill the Sandwiches: Place the assembled sandwiches on the preheated skillet. Cook for about 3-4 minutes on each side, or until the bread is golden brown and crispy, and the cheese is melted and gooey. Be sure to press down slightly with a spatula to get a good sear.
- Serve: Once done, remove the sandwiches from the skillet and let them cool slightly on a cutting board. Slice each sandwich in half and serve warm.
Extra Tips:
For the best results, confirm that the bread you use is fresh and sturdy, as softer bread may not hold up well to the melting cheese and juicy tomatoes.
Consider using flavored olive oil, such as garlic or basil-infused, to add an extra layer of flavor to your sandwiches. If you prefer a more robust flavor, you can add a sprinkle of dried oregano or a pinch of red pepper flakes to the feta cheese before assembling the sandwiches.
Remember to adjust cooking times based on the thickness of your bread and the heat of your stove to avoid burning.
Bacon Jam Savory Sweet Griller

The Bacon Jam Savory Sweet Griller is a delightful twist on the classic grilled cheese sandwich, combining the smoky richness of bacon with the sweet tanginess of caramelized onions and a hint of apple cider vinegar. This sandwich is perfect for those who crave a blend of savory and sweet flavors, making it an ideal choice for brunch or a cozy lunch.
The crispy, golden-brown bread encases a gooey, melty cheese interior that pairs beautifully with the homemade bacon jam, creating a unique and satisfying culinary experience.
To make this dish, you’ll prepare a batch of bacon jam, which serves as the savory-sweet heart of the sandwich. The process involves slowly cooking bacon until crispy, then blending it with onions, garlic, brown sugar, and apple cider vinegar to create a thick, spreadable jam.
Once the bacon jam is ready, it’s layered with your choice of cheese between slices of hearty bread, then grilled to perfection. This recipe serves 4-6 people, making it a fantastic choice for family gatherings or a casual dinner party.
Ingredients (Serves 4-6):
- 12 slices of thick-cut bacon
- 2 large onions, finely sliced
- 3 cloves of garlic, minced
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 1/4 cup apple cider vinegar
- 1/4 cup maple syrup
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 8 slices of your choice of bread (e.g., sourdough, rye, or whole grain)
- 2 cups of shredded cheese (e.g., cheddar, Gruyère, or mozzarella)
- 4 tablespoons butter
Instructions:
- Cook the Bacon: In a large skillet over medium heat, cook the bacon until crispy. Transfer the bacon to a paper towel-lined plate and set aside. Reserve about 2 tablespoons of bacon fat in the skillet for added flavor.
- Prepare the Onions and Garlic: Add the sliced onions to the skillet with the reserved bacon fat and cook over medium heat until they’re softened and begin to caramelize, about 10-12 minutes. Stir in the minced garlic and cook for an additional 2 minutes.
- Make the Bacon Jam: Chop the cooked bacon into small pieces and add it back to the skillet with the onions. Stir in the brown sugar, apple cider vinegar, maple syrup, black pepper, and salt. Reduce the heat to low and let the mixture simmer, stirring occasionally, until it thickens to a jam-like consistency, about 20-25 minutes. Remove from heat and let it cool slightly.
- Assemble the Sandwiches: Spread a generous layer of bacon jam on a slice of bread, top with shredded cheese, and then cover with another slice of bread. Repeat with the remaining ingredients to make additional sandwiches.
- Grill the Sandwiches: Heat a skillet or griddle over medium heat. Spread butter on the outside of each sandwich. Place the sandwiches in the skillet and cook until the bread is golden brown and the cheese is melted, about 3-4 minutes per side. Adjust the heat as necessary to prevent burning.
- Serve: Once grilled, remove the sandwiches from the skillet, let them cool for a minute, then slice in half and serve warm.
Extra Tips:
For added depth of flavor, consider adding a splash of bourbon to the bacon jam during the simmering process.
Feel free to customize the cheese selection according to your preference; a mix of sharp cheddar and creamy mozzarella works particularly well.
If you prefer a slightly spicier kick, sprinkle in a pinch of cayenne pepper to the bacon jam.
Make sure to keep an eye on the sandwiches while grilling to guarantee they don’t burn; adjusting the heat is key to perfecting the crispy exterior.
Spinach Artichoke Dip Sandwich

Indulge in a delightful twist on a classic comfort food with the Spinach Artichoke Dip Sandwich. This specialty grilled cheese sandwich combines the creamy, cheesy goodness of spinach artichoke dip with the satisfying crunch of toasted bread. Perfect as a lunch or dinner option, this sandwich offers the savory flavors of garlic, spinach, and artichoke hearts, melted together with gooey cheese between layers of golden, buttery bread.
Whether you’re serving it at a casual family gathering or treating yourself to a gourmet meal at home, this sandwich is bound to be a hit.
Creating these sandwiches for 4-6 people is simple and rewarding. The key is to use fresh ingredients and take your time to achieve the perfect balance of crispy bread and creamy filling. The recipe involves preparing a rich spinach artichoke spread, which is then generously layered between slices of bread and grilled to perfection.
With the right ingredients and a little bit of patience, you’ll have a restaurant-quality dish that will impress even the pickiest eaters.
Ingredients (Serves 4-6):
- 8-12 slices of sourdough or country-style bread
- 1 (10-ounce) package of frozen spinach, thawed and drained
- 1 (14-ounce) can of artichoke hearts, drained and chopped
- 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1/2 cup cream cheese, softened
- 1/4 cup mayonnaise
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 4 tablespoons butter, softened
Cooking Instructions:
- Prepare the Spinach Artichoke Mixture: In a large mixing bowl, combine the thawed and drained spinach, chopped artichoke hearts, mozzarella cheese, Parmesan cheese, cream cheese, mayonnaise, minced garlic, salt, and black pepper. Mix thoroughly until all ingredients are well combined and the mixture is smooth and creamy.
- Assemble the Sandwiches: Lay out the slices of bread on a clean surface. Spread a generous amount of the spinach artichoke mixture onto half of the bread slices. Top each with another slice of bread to form a sandwich.
- Butter the Bread: Spread softened butter evenly on the outside of each sandwich. This will help create a golden, crispy crust when grilling.
- Grill the Sandwiches: Heat a large skillet or griddle over medium heat. Place the sandwiches in the skillet, buttered side down. Cook for about 3-4 minutes on each side, or until the bread is golden brown and the cheese inside is melted. Adjust the heat as necessary to avoid burning.
- Serve: Once cooked, remove the sandwiches from the skillet and let them cool slightly before serving. Slice each sandwich in half and serve warm.
Extra Tips:
For the best results, use good quality bread that can hold up to the weight of the filling and provide a satisfying crunch. If you prefer a stronger cheese flavor, consider adding a bit of sharp cheddar to the mix.
Confirm the spinach is thoroughly drained to avoid a soggy sandwich. If you’re in a hurry or need to serve a crowd, consider preparing the spinach artichoke mixture ahead of time and refrigerating it until you’re ready to assemble and grill the sandwiches.
Enjoy your culinary creation with a side of soup or a fresh salad for a complete meal.
Gouda and Caramelized Onion Toast

Gouda and Caramelized Onion Toast is a delightful twist on the classic grilled cheese sandwich, offering a perfect blend of creamy, melty gouda cheese and sweet, savory caramelized onions. This gourmet sandwich is perfect for an indulgent lunch or a comforting dinner.
The rich flavors of the gouda complement the sweet and slightly tangy taste of the caramelized onions, creating a sophisticated yet simple sandwich that will impress anyone who tastes it.
To make this delicious dish, you’ll start by preparing the caramelized onions, which require a bit of patience but are well worth the effort. Once the onions are ready, you’ll assemble the sandwiches and toast them to golden perfection. This recipe serves 4-6 people, making it ideal for a family meal or a small gathering.
Pair it with a fresh salad or a warm bowl of soup for a complete and satisfying meal.
Ingredients (serves 4-6):
- 8-12 slices of sourdough bread
- 2-3 tablespoons of butter
- 2 large onions, thinly sliced
- 1 tablespoon of olive oil
- 1 tablespoon of brown sugar
- 1 teaspoon of balsamic vinegar
- 8-12 slices of gouda cheese
- Salt and pepper to taste
Cooking Instructions:
1. Caramelize the Onions: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the sliced onions and a pinch of salt. Cook, stirring occasionally, until the onions are soft and starting to brown, about 10 minutes.
Stir in the brown sugar and balsamic vinegar, and continue to cook for another 15-20 minutes until the onions are deeply caramelized. Remove from heat and set aside.
2. Prepare the Bread: Lay out the slices of sourdough bread. Butter one side of each slice generously. This will be the outside of the sandwich that gets grilled.
3. Assemble the Sandwiches: Place 1-2 slices of gouda cheese on the unbuttered side of half of the bread slices. Top with a generous spoonful of caramelized onions, then cover with another slice of bread, buttered side out.
4. Grill the Sandwiches: Heat a large skillet or griddle over medium heat. Place the sandwiches in the skillet and cook for 3-4 minutes on each side, or until the bread is golden brown and the cheese has melted.
Press down gently with a spatula to guarantee even cooking.
5. Serve: Remove the sandwiches from the skillet, let them cool for a minute, then cut in half and serve warm.
Extra Tips:
For best results, use a good-quality gouda cheese, as it will melt better and provide a richer flavor.
Be patient while caramelizing the onions; low and slow is key to achieving the deep, sweet flavor that makes this sandwich special. If you prefer a spicier kick, add a pinch of chili flakes to the onions while they caramelize.
Finally, verify your skillet isn’t too hot, as this could lead to the bread burning before the cheese has a chance to melt properly.
Blue Cheese and Pear Combo

For those who love to experiment with their grilled cheese sandwiches, the Blue Cheese and Pear Combo offers a delightful twist on the traditional classic. This recipe combines the creamy tang of blue cheese with the natural sweetness of ripe pears, creating a savory yet sweet sandwich that tantalizes the taste buds. The contrast of flavors is perfectly balanced with a touch of honey and a sprinkle of walnuts, making it an irresistible choice for a special lunch or dinner.
The Blue Cheese and Pear Grilled Cheese Sandwich isn’t only delicious but also easy to prepare. It’s ideal for serving a small group of friends or family, providing a gourmet experience in the comfort of your home. The recipe below is designed to make enough for 4-6 people, guaranteeing everyone gets a taste of this exquisite combination.
Ingredients (serving size: 4-6 people):
- 8 slices of sourdough bread
- 1 cup crumbled blue cheese
- 2 ripe pears, thinly sliced
- 1/4 cup honey
- 1/2 cup walnuts, chopped
- 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
- 1/2 cup arugula (optional)
Cooking Instructions:
- Prepare the Ingredients: Begin by washing the pears thoroughly and slicing them thinly. Crumble the blue cheese if it isn’t already done, and chop the walnuts into small pieces.
- Assemble the Sandwiches: Lay out the sourdough bread slices on a clean surface. Evenly distribute the blue cheese across four slices of bread. Add a layer of sliced pears on top of the cheese. Drizzle honey over the pears and sprinkle with chopped walnuts. Top each sandwich with a handful of arugula if desired, and cover with the remaining slices of bread.
- Butter the Bread: Spread a thin layer of unsalted butter on the outside of each slice of bread. This will guarantee a golden, crispy texture once grilled.
- Grill the Sandwiches: Heat a non-stick skillet or griddle over medium heat. Place the sandwiches onto the skillet, butter side down. Cook for about 3-4 minutes on each side, or until the bread is golden brown and the cheese has melted.
- Serve: Remove the sandwiches from the skillet and let them cool slightly before slicing in half. Serve warm, allowing the flavors to meld beautifully with each bite.
Extra Tips:
- For a more intense flavor, consider using a mix of different blue cheese varieties.
- Verify the pears are ripe but firm for the best texture.
- If you prefer a less sweet sandwich, reduce the amount of honey drizzled on the pears.
- To add a bit of spice, a light sprinkle of freshly ground black pepper can complement the sweetness of the pears beautifully.
- Always preheat your skillet to guarantee even cooking and a perfect golden crust.
Avocado and Pepper Jack Stack

For those who love the creamy texture of avocado and the spicy kick of pepper jack cheese, the Avocado and Pepper Jack Stack grilled cheese sandwich is a perfect choice. This specialty sandwich combines the richness of ripe avocados with the bold flavors of pepper jack cheese, creating a delectable bite that’s both satisfying and exciting to the palate.
The sandwich is layered with fresh ingredients, making it not just a treat for the taste buds but also a feast for the eyes. Whether you’re hosting a casual lunch or simply indulging in a comfort food craving, this grilled cheese variation is sure to impress.
The combination of creamy avocado, spicy pepper jack, and crispy bread makes for a deliciously balanced meal. This recipe serves 4-6 people, making it ideal for family gatherings or small get-togethers. The key to the perfect Avocado and Pepper Jack Stack is in the balance of flavors and textures.
The creamy avocado complements the spicy cheese, while the crisp bread adds the perfect crunch. With the right ingredients and a little bit of patience, you can create a mouthwatering sandwich that everyone will love.
Ingredients (Serves 4-6):
- 8-12 slices of sourdough bread
- 2 ripe avocados
- 12 slices of pepper jack cheese
- 1 red onion, thinly sliced
- 1 tomato, thinly sliced
- 2 tablespoons of lime juice
- 1 tablespoon of olive oil
- 1/4 cup of fresh cilantro, chopped
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Butter for grilling
Cooking Instructions:
- Prepare the Avocado Spread:
- Cut the avocados in half, remove the pits, and scoop the flesh into a bowl.
- Add lime juice, salt, and pepper to the avocado, then mash with a fork until smooth and creamy.
- Assemble the Sandwich:
- Lay out the slices of sourdough bread on a clean surface.
- Spread a generous amount of the avocado mixture on half of the slices.
- Layer each with slices of pepper jack cheese, red onion, and tomato.
- Sprinkle chopped cilantro over the top for added flavor.
- Place another slice of bread on top to form a sandwich.
- Grill the Sandwiches:
- Heat a large skillet or griddle over medium heat.
- Add a small amount of olive oil and butter to the pan.
- Carefully place the sandwiches in the skillet, cooking them in batches if necessary.
- Grill each side for about 3-4 minutes or until the bread is golden brown and the cheese is melted.
- Serve:
- Remove the sandwiches from the skillet and let them cool slightly.
- Slice each sandwich in half and serve warm.
Extra Tips:
For the best results, choose avocados that are ripe but not overripe. They should yield slightly to pressure without being mushy.
If you prefer an extra kick, consider adding a few slices of jalapeño or a dash of hot sauce to the avocado spread. Additionally, using a panini press can provide an even crispier texture and help the cheese melt perfectly.
Remember to adjust the seasoning to your taste, and don’t forget to enjoy the process of creating this flavorful and satisfying sandwich.
Lobster and Gruyere Indulgence

Elevate your sandwich game with the decadent Lobster and Gruyere Indulgence, a sophisticated take on the classic grilled cheese that promises to tantalize your taste buds. This luxurious sandwich combines succulent chunks of lobster meat with the rich and nutty flavor of Gruyere cheese, all enveloped in perfectly toasted sourdough bread.
The addition of fresh herbs and a hint of lemon zest enhances the natural sweetness of the lobster, creating a harmonious blend of flavors that will leave you craving more. Perfect for a special brunch or a gourmet lunch, this recipe serves 4-6 people and provides an unforgettable culinary experience.
Whether you’re hosting a gathering or treating yourself to a gourmet meal, the Lobster and Gruyere Indulgence offers a touch of elegance and indulgence. Pair it with a crisp white wine or a light salad for a complete dining experience that’s sure to impress.
Ingredients (serves 4-6):
- 1 1/2 pounds cooked lobster meat, roughly chopped
- 8 slices of sourdough bread
- 2 cups shredded Gruyere cheese
- 4 tablespoons unsalted butter, softened
- 2 tablespoons mayonnaise
- 1 tablespoon fresh chives, finely chopped
- 1 tablespoon fresh parsley, finely chopped
- Zest of 1 lemon
- Salt and pepper, to taste
Cooking Instructions:
- Prepare the Lobster Filling: In a medium bowl, combine the chopped lobster meat, mayonnaise, chives, parsley, lemon zest, salt, and pepper. Mix gently until all ingredients are well incorporated. This mixture will serve as the flavorful heart of your sandwich.
- Preheat the Skillet: Heat a large non-stick skillet or griddle over medium heat. While waiting for the skillet to heat, spread a thin layer of softened butter on one side of each slice of sourdough bread.
- Assemble the Sandwiches: Lay out four slices of bread, buttered side down. Evenly distribute the lobster mixture on the unbuttered side of each slice. Top the lobster with a generous amount of shredded Gruyere cheese, and then place another slice of bread on top, buttered side up.
- Grill the Sandwiches: Place the assembled sandwiches onto the preheated skillet. Cook for about 3-4 minutes on one side, pressing gently with a spatula, until the bread turns golden brown and the cheese begins to melt.
- Flip and Finish: Carefully flip each sandwich and continue to cook for an additional 3-4 minutes on the other side, until the cheese is fully melted and the bread is crisp and golden.
- Serve: Once cooked, remove the sandwiches from the skillet and let them rest for a minute before slicing them in half. This allows the cheese to set slightly and prevents it from spilling out.
Extra Tips:
For the best results, use fresh lobster meat from your local seafood market, as it tends to have more flavor and a better texture than pre-packaged options. If you’re short on time, consider using pre-cooked lobster tails.
Be sure to let the sandwiches rest briefly after grilling to make certain the cheese stays inside the bread when cutting. If you prefer a slightly tangy and creamy note, add a thin layer of Dijon mustard on the inside of the bread before adding the lobster mixture.
Enjoy your Lobster and Gruyere Indulgence with a crisp green salad or a light seafood bisque for a truly luxurious meal.
Vegan Cashew Cheese Veggie Blend

Indulge in a delightful Vegan Cashew Cheese Veggie Blend Grilled Cheese Sandwich, a perfect combination of creamy, nutty cashew cheese and a medley of fresh vegetables, all encased in crispy, golden brown bread.
This sandwich isn’t only a treat for vegans but also for anyone looking to explore new flavors and textures in a classic comfort food. The homemade cashew cheese provides a rich and savory base that pairs beautifully with the crunchy and colorful vegetables, making each bite a burst of flavor and health.
Whether you’re preparing a hearty lunch or a satisfying dinner, this recipe is designed to serve 4-6 people, guaranteeing everyone gets a taste of this delicious creation.
Enjoy the balance of textures, from the creamy cheese to the crunchy veggies, all while knowing you’re indulging in a nutritious, plant-based meal. Let’s explore the ingredients and steps needed to make this specialty grilled cheese sandwich.
Ingredients (Serves 4-6):
- 2 cups raw cashews, soaked for 2-4 hours
- 1/4 cup nutritional yeast
- 2 tablespoons lemon juice
- 1 clove garlic
- 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 cup water
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 red bell pepper, thinly sliced
- 1 zucchini, thinly sliced
- 1 cup fresh spinach
- 8-12 slices of whole grain bread
- Vegan butter or margarine for spreading
Cooking Instructions:
1. Prepare the Cashew Cheese: Drain the soaked cashews and place them in a blender. Add nutritional yeast, lemon juice, garlic, onion powder, salt, and water. Blend until smooth and creamy. Adjust the seasoning if needed.
2. Saute the Vegetables: In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add the sliced red bell pepper and zucchini. Cook for about 5 minutes until they start to soften.
Add the spinach and cook for another 2 minutes until wilted. Remove from heat and set aside.
3. Assemble the Sandwiches: Spread a generous layer of cashew cheese on one side of each slice of bread. On half of the slices, distribute the sautéed vegetables evenly.
4. Close the Sandwiches: Top the vegetable-covered slices with the remaining bread slices, cheese side down, to form sandwiches.
5. Grill the Sandwiches: Spread vegan butter on the outer sides of each sandwich. Heat a skillet or griddle over medium heat. Place the sandwiches in the skillet and cook for about 3-4 minutes on each side, pressing gently with a spatula, until the bread is golden brown and crispy.
6. Serve: Remove the sandwiches from the skillet and let them cool slightly before cutting them in half. Serve warm and enjoy the melty, savory delight.
Extra Tips:
For the best results, make sure the cashew cheese is smooth and creamy by blending it thoroughly; a high-speed blender works best for this purpose.
If you prefer a spicier kick, consider adding a pinch of cayenne pepper or a dash of hot sauce to the cashew cheese mixture. Additionally, feel free to experiment with different vegetables based on your preferences or seasonal availability.
Egg and Cheese Breakfast Melt

Elevate your mornings with the Egg and Cheese Breakfast Melt, a delightful twist on the classic grilled cheese sandwich. This savory creation combines the comforting flavors of eggs, gooey cheese, and crispy bread, making it an ideal breakfast or brunch option. The secret lies in the perfect balance of ingredients and the right cooking technique to guarantee every bite is a harmonious blend of textures and flavors.
Whether you’re cooking for your family or hosting a brunch with friends, this recipe is sure to impress and satisfy.
The Egg and Cheese Breakfast Melt isn’t only quick to prepare but also versatile, allowing you to customize it with your favorite herbs, spices, and additional toppings. Imagine starting your day with the rich taste of melted cheese intertwined with perfectly cooked eggs, all encased in a golden, crispy exterior.
This dish is designed to serve 4-6 people, making it an excellent choice for a group breakfast or a leisurely weekend brunch. Gather your ingredients and get ready to create a breakfast masterpiece that will become a staple in your recipe collection.
Ingredients (Serves 4-6):
- 8 large eggs
- 1/4 cup milk
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- 2 tablespoons butter
- 12 slices of bread (your choice of variety)
- 12 slices of cheese (cheddar, American, or your choice)
- 6 tablespoons mayonnaise
- Optional: fresh herbs (such as chives or parsley), cooked bacon or ham slices
Cooking Instructions:
- Prepare the Egg Mixture: Crack the eggs into a bowl, add the milk, and whisk together until fully combined. Season the mixture with salt and pepper to taste.
- Cook the Eggs: In a large non-stick skillet, melt 1 tablespoon of butter over medium heat. Pour in the egg mixture and cook, stirring gently, until the eggs are scrambled and just cooked. Remove from heat and set aside.
- Assemble the Sandwiches: Lay out the bread slices. Spread a thin layer of mayonnaise on one side of each slice. On the un-mayoed side of half the slices, place a slice of cheese, followed by a generous portion of the scrambled eggs, and another slice of cheese. Top with the remaining bread slices, mayo side out.
- Grill the Sandwiches: Heat a large skillet or griddle over medium heat. Melt the remaining tablespoon of butter. Place the sandwiches in the skillet and cook for about 3-4 minutes on each side, or until the bread is golden brown and the cheese has melted. Adjust the heat as necessary to avoid burning.
- Serve: Remove the sandwiches from the heat and let them cool slightly before cutting them in half. Serve immediately, garnished with fresh herbs or additional toppings if desired.
Extra Tips:
For an even richer flavor, try using a combination of cheeses like mozzarella and Swiss in addition to cheddar. If you prefer a spicy kick, add a dash of hot sauce to the egg mixture or sprinkle some chili flakes onto the cheese before grilling.
To prevent the sandwiches from becoming soggy, guarantee the eggs aren’t overly wet, and use a sturdy bread that can hold up to the moisture. Finally, using mayonnaise instead of butter on the outside of the bread helps achieve an extra crispy and golden crust.
Enjoy your Egg and Cheese Breakfast Melt with a side of fresh fruit or a cup of coffee for a complete breakfast experience.
Chocolate and Banana Dessert Grilled Cheese

Indulge in a delightful twist on the classic grilled cheese with this Chocolate and Banana Dessert Grilled Cheese. Perfect for satisfying your sweet tooth, this sandwich combines the rich, creamy taste of chocolate with the sweet, soft texture of bananas, all nestled between two slices of perfectly toasted bread.
It’s an innovative and delicious way to enjoy dessert in sandwich form and is bound to be a hit at both family gatherings and casual dinner parties.
This recipe is designed to serve 4-6 people, making it ideal for sharing. The preparation is simple, and the result is a gooey, mouthwatering treat that balances sweetness with a hint of savory goodness from the buttered bread. Whether you’re looking for a unique dessert option or a fun snack to enjoy, this Chocolate and Banana Dessert Grilled Cheese is bound to please.
Ingredients (Serving Size: 4-6 people):
- 8-12 slices of bread (white, whole wheat, or brioche)
- 2-3 bananas, sliced
- 1 cup of chocolate chips or chocolate spread
- 1/2 cup of unsalted butter, softened
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- Optional: powdered sugar for dusting
Cooking Instructions:
- Prepare the Ingredients: Begin by slicing the bananas into thin rounds and set them aside. If using chocolate chips, consider melting them slightly in a microwave or double boiler for easier spreading.
- Butter the Bread: Spread a thin layer of softened butter on one side of each slice of bread. This will guarantee a golden, crispy exterior when grilled.
- Assemble the Sandwiches: Place the buttered side down of one slice of bread on a clean surface. Spread a generous layer of chocolate spread or melted chocolate chips on the unbuttered side. Arrange the banana slices evenly over the chocolate. Add a small splash of vanilla extract over the bananas for added flavor. Top with another slice of bread, buttered side facing up.
- Preheat the Pan: Heat a non-stick skillet or griddle over medium heat. Confirm the surface is adequately heated before placing the sandwiches to achieve an even toast.
- Grill the Sandwiches: Place the assembled sandwiches in the skillet, buttered side down. Cook each side for about 3-4 minutes until the bread is golden brown and crispy, and the chocolate is melted. Use a spatula to press down slightly on the sandwiches to help the ingredients meld together.
- Serve: Remove the sandwiches from the skillet and allow them to cool slightly. Slice them diagonally for a classic presentation. If desired, dust with powdered sugar before serving.
Extra Tips:
For an even richer flavor, consider using a mix of milk and dark chocolate. If you prefer a nuttier taste, add a sprinkle of chopped nuts such as walnuts or almonds between the banana and chocolate layers before grilling.
Confirm that the butter is well softened for easy spreading, and if the bread seems too dry, add a little extra butter to achieve that perfect crispy texture. Keep an eye on the heat to prevent burning, adjusting it as necessary to cook the sandwiches evenly.
Enjoy these sandwiches fresh off the skillet for the best taste and texture.
